[v2,net-next,4/7] xen-netback: immediately wake tx queue when guest rx queue has space

When an skb is removed from the guest rx queue, immediately wake the
tx queue, instead of after processing them.

Patch

diff --git a/drivers/net/xen-netback/rx.c b/drivers/net/xen-netback/rx.c
index b0ce4c6..9548709 100644
--- a/drivers/net/xen-netback/rx.c
+++ b/drivers/net/xen-netback/rx.c
@@ -92,27 +92,21 @@  static struct sk_buff *xenvif_rx_dequeue(struct xenvif_queue *queue)
 	spin_lock_irq(&queue->rx_queue.lock);
 
 	skb = __skb_dequeue(&queue->rx_queue);
-	if (skb)
+	if (skb) {
 		queue->rx_queue_len -= skb->len;
+		if (queue->rx_queue_len < queue->rx_queue_max) {
+			struct netdev_queue *txq;
+
+			txq = netdev_get_tx_queue(queue->vif->dev, queue->id);
+			netif_tx_wake_queue(txq);
+		}
+	}
 
 	spin_unlock_irq(&queue->rx_queue.lock);
 
 	return skb;
 }
 
-static void xenvif_rx_queue_maybe_wake(struct xenvif_queue *queue)
-{
-	spin_lock_irq(&queue->rx_queue.lock);
-
-	if (queue->rx_queue_len < queue->rx_queue_max) {
-		struct net_device *dev = queue->vif->dev;
-
-		netif_tx_wake_queue(netdev_get_tx_queue(dev, queue->id));
-	}
-
-	spin_unlock_irq(&queue->rx_queue.lock);
-}
-
 static void xenvif_rx_queue_purge(struct xenvif_queue *queue)
 {
 	struct sk_buff *skb;
@@ -585,8 +579,6 @@  int xenvif_kthread_guest_rx(void *data)
 		 */
 		xenvif_rx_queue_drop_expired(queue);
 
-		xenvif_rx_queue_maybe_wake(queue);
-
 		cond_resched();
 	}
